2,147,484,150 is a composite number, even.
2,147,484,150 (two billion one hundred forty-seven million four hundred eighty-four thousand one hundred fifty) is an even 10-digit number. It is a composite number with 240 divisors, and factors as 2 × 3⁴ × 5² × 7 × 211 × 359. Its proper divisors sum to 4,723,147,530,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x800001F6.

Interpreted as seconds since the Unix epoch (Jan 1 1970 UTC), this is 2038-01-19 03:22:30 UTC (weekday:Tuesday).
Many software systems represent time this way; very common in logs and APIs.
